Default Beginner’s Guide to Web Hosting

Web hosting is an often overlooked, critical part of what makes the Internet function. Web hosting is the service that lets both individual people and businesses create their own spot on the internet, called a website. Companies that provide web hosting services have servers on which the data that makes up the website is hosted. Website owners, called webmasters, give their data files to the web host for storage and publication to the internet. This is what allows people anywhere to use the internet to access that person or company’s website.

Regardless of the provider you select, your web hosting service will provide your website with many benefits. The first and most basic is a simple presence on the internet. This provides you with storage space for all of the files and data that comprise your website, including pictures, audio or video. An average amount of space that a web hosting service provider provides to a webmaster is approximately 1GB, but some more expensive website hosting packages can provide as much as one hundred times that amount, or even more.

As you can see, web hosting services provide you with a whole range of options for this essential piece of your website puzzle. No matter what you need, there is a package for you.

Nice information! Web hosting allows individuals, companies and other organizations to make their Web site available and accessible via the Internet. Web hosts offer a number of other services. Perhaps most important is a quality level of internet connectivity, in terms of reliability and speed. Having a high quality control panel is also a big plus when considering a web host. A control panel allows your web master much greater access and control over the functioning of the Web site.
